Apollo 11 Manual

On 20 July 1969, US astronaut Neil Armstrong became the first man to walk on the moon. This title presents the story of the Apollo 11 mission and the 'space hardware' that made it possible. It looks at the evolution and design of the mighty Saturn V rocket, the Command and Service Modules, and the Lunar Module.
